Poultry integrator files for bankruptcy in US

In the US a poultry integrator  business has filed for bankruptcy, Allen's Family Foods is struggling after 91 years as a poultry integrator, the CEO and President Robert Turley has set in motion 60 days of business restructuring and industry change. Turley said "the increase in corn from US$3.50 (€2.453) to US$8.50 (€5.958) was to blame, with poultry feed being it's highest input cost".

The company employs 2,273 people and packs about eight million pounds of poultry a week. Allen's Family Foods own 28 grow out farms and has contracts with 271 producers between Delmarva and North Carolina. a purchase agreement with Millsboro-based Mountaire Farms would buy Allen hatcheries in Seaford and Dagsboro, the Seaford administrative office, a Seaford feed mill, processing plants in Harbeson and Cordova and a rendering plant called JCR Enterprises in Linkwood.
